Fans are an essential part of many industrial and commercial applications, used for tasks such as ventilation, dust collection and material handling. As technology advances, innovative features are being incorporated into modern fan designs to improve performance, efficiency and reliability. Whether you’re purchasing a new blower or looking to upgrade your existing equipment, it’s essential to be up to date with the latest innovations in blower design. Here are some innovative features to look for in modern blower designs.
1. Variable speed drives
Variable speed drives (VSD) are becoming increasingly popular in modern blower designs. VSDs provide precise control of the fan motor, allowing operators to adjust fan speed based on specific application requirements. This not only improves energy efficiency, but also reduces wear and tear on the fan, extending its lifespan.
2. Integrated control and monitoring systems
Integrating advanced control and monitoring systems into booster design can provide significant performance and maintenance benefits. Modern fans with integrated control systems enable real-time monitoring of key performance indicators, such as temperature, vibration and energy consumption. This allows operators to detect and resolve potential issues before they result in downtime or costly repairs.
3. High efficiency wheels
Improvements in turbine design have significantly increased the efficiency of modern superchargers. High-efficiency impellers are designed to maximize airflow while minimizing energy consumption, resulting in significant savings over fan life. Look for modern fan designs that incorporate advanced turbine technology to ensure optimal performance and energy efficiency.
4. Noise reduction features
Noise pollution is a common concern in industrial and commercial environments, and modern blower designs increasingly aim to alleviate this problem. Innovative noise reduction features, such as acoustic enclosures and sound-absorbing materials, can significantly reduce noise levels generated by fans without compromising performance. By choosing a fan with effective noise reduction features, operators can create a more comfortable and productive working environment.
5. Modular construction
Modular construction is a key feature of modern booster designs that offer significant advantages in flexibility and ease of maintenance. Modular construction fans allow easy access to key components, making routine maintenance and repairs quicker and simpler. Additionally, modular designs allow operators to customize the fan to meet specific application requirements, ensuring optimal performance under various operating conditions.
6. Remote monitoring and diagnostics
Remote monitoring and diagnostic capabilities have revolutionized the way industrial equipment, including blowers, is managed and maintained. Modern blower designs with integrated remote monitoring and diagnostics systems allow operators to access real-time performance data and receive alerts on potential issues from anywhere with an Internet connection. This proactive approach to maintenance can help avoid costly downtime and lost productivity.
